About Portadown Train Station Park and Ride
Portadown Train Station Park and Ride is a park and ride facility in Portadown, designed for drivers who want to leave their car and take the bus into the centre. At approximately 412 spaces (estimated from the site’s footprint), this is one of the bigger car parks you’ll find nearby. This is a surface car park, so expect open-air parking at ground level. Parking is free of charge. It is operated by Northern Ireland Railways.
